News Headlines for School Assembly, February 14th: From Bhopal police arresting two men on charges of rape, extortion and criminal intimidation involving a Class 11 student to the BSE Sensex ending 1,048.16 points lower, here are the top news highlights of the day.

Top National News:

– The Indian Armed Forces are set to receive additional S-400 missiles from Russia, after the Defence Acquisition Council granted the Acceptance of Necessity (AoN) for combat missiles, government sources told CNN-News18. These new missiles are intended for existing S-400 batteries.

– Police in Bhopal arrested two men on charges of rape, extortion and criminal intimidation involving a Class 11 student from a prominent school in the city’s Shahpura area. The accused, identified as Ausaf Ali Khan and Maaz Khan, a gym owner, allegedly raped the minor student multiple times, filmed the assault and used the video to extort money from her, police said.

Top International News:

– Thorbjørn Jagland, Norway’s former prime minister, has been charged with “aggravated corruption” over alleged benefits received from the late US financier and convicted sex offender Jeffrey Epstein.

– As Bangladesh voted in its 13th parliamentary elections, exiled Prime Minister Sheikh Hasina’s son Sajeeb Wazed has signalled a possible political outreach to the Bangladesh Nationalist Party (BNP), calling it the country’s “major party” and suggesting lines of communication could open soon.

Top Sports News:

– A 44-year-old Slovak national who had been on Italy’s wanted list for 16 years was arrested in Milan on Wednesday evening, according to a statement from the Carabinieri police force.

Top Business News:

– Dalal Street saw heavy selling on Friday as bearish momentum dominated, extending losses in Indian equities amid a sustained global tech sell-off that hit major IT stocks. The BSE Sensex ended 1,048.16 points lower, or 1.25%, at 82,626.76, while the NSE Nifty50 dropped 336.1 points, or 1.30%, to 25,471.1.

Top Education News:

– Mahashivratri, the major festival dedicated to Lord Shiva, occurs in February this year. Several states, including Uttar Pradesh, Delhi, Punjab, and Bihar, have announced school holidays.
